BIOGRAPHY

Aron Silver is an award-winning author from the Netherlands. His latest work, Mrs. Cleyton, is currently in the late stages of editing and is expected to arrive in April, 2026. It is a psychological thriller set near Brighton, Sussex, South England.

His debut novel was titled Child of the Moon and is a slow-burning horror mystery set in Scotland, 1924. For it, he won the Gold Modal in the Horror Category of the Global Book Awards.

Occasionally, he also writes short stories.
